NMSU names health, human services dean

LAS CRUCES (AP) -- A 60-year-old Virginia man has been named dean of New Mexico State University's College of Health and Social Services.

Tilahun Adera, a native of Ethiopia, will start July 1 at a salary of $165,000.

He currently is senior associate dean for public health and a professor of epidemiology and community health at Virginia Commonwealth University School of Medicine.

Adera holds a pharmacy degree, a masters in environmental health and another in public health and a doctorate in public health.

The college's associate dean, Larry Olsen, left his job last year after accusations he e-mailed pornography to a professor, and department head James Robinson stepped down.

Olsen and Robinson were among those named in a lawsuit last September accusing NMSU administrators of racial discrimination and professional retaliation.
